• 08-08-2020, 12:50:03
    #10
    preg_match_all("@<div class='result_thumb ' style='background-image: url\\((.*?)\\)'>s*</div>@si",$kaynak2,$tumresimler);
  • 08-08-2020, 12:51:05
    #11
    XAWeb adlı üyeden alıntı: mesajı görüntüle
    Temizlemek için replace'de kullanabilirsin preg'de kullanabilirsin örnek;
    <?php
    $input = "(test)";
    preg_match_all('/\((.*?)\)/', $input, $matches);
    print_R($matches);
    hocam bu kullanım nedir başında /(
  • 08-08-2020, 12:52:37
    #12
    hesapadim adlı üyeden alıntı: mesajı görüntüle
    preg_match_all("@<div class='result_thumb ' style='background-image: url\\((.*?)\\)'>s*</div>@si",$kaynak2,$tumresimler);
    aranılan cevap geldi çift kaçış yapmak lazım dalgınlık işte=) süpersin
  • 08-08-2020, 15:27:55
    #13
    zeytin8899 adlı üyeden alıntı: mesajı görüntüle
    hocam bu kullanım nedir başında /(
    Eşleştirmelerde daha düzenli ifadeler elde etmek için kullanıyoruz. İyi çalışmalar dilerim
    <?php
    
    $konu = <<<FOO
    a: 1
    b: 2
    c: 3
    FOO;
    
    preg_match_all('/(?<harf>\w+): (?<rakam>\d+)/', $konu, $eslesenler);
    
    print_r($eslesenler);
    
    ?>
    Yukarıdaki örneğin çıktısı:
    Array
    (
    [0] => Array
    (
    [0] => a: 1
    [1] => b: 2
    [2] => c: 3
    )
    
    [harf] => Array
    (
    [0] => a
    [1] => b
    [2] => c
    )
    
    [1] => Array
    (
    [0] => a
    [1] => b
    [2] => c
    )
    
    [rakam] => Array
    (
    [0] => 1
    [1] => 2
    [2] => 3
    )
    
    [2] => Array
    (
    [0] => 1
    [1] => 2
    [2] => 3
    )
    
    )
  • 09-08-2020, 13:35:05
    #14
    preg_match("#<div class='result_thumb ' style='background-image: url\((.*?)\)'>s*</div>#si",$kaynak2,$tumresimler);